connman: Tweak main.conf for cluster demo support

When running the cluster demo, we do not want the second ethernet
interface managed by connman, as it will be used for a separate
connection to the cluster board, and should not be considered part
of the shared connection pool.  To do this, NetworkInterfaceBlacklist
is tweaked if agl-cluster-demo-support is enabled.
